Describe the benefits/advantages and challenges/risks of using social media for public health communication
Social media has revolutionized the way the public consumes information. It is fairly decentralized compared to the traditional media and it despite its many advantages, it still harbors many challenges that limit it as a source of the authoritative information source. One of the main advantages of social media is that it is used by many people daily and for many hours. Information routed through social media is thus likely to reach many people within a short period of time. Social media enables users to relay feedback to the information sources whether individual or from an organization. This is unlike traditional media where feedback was slow and mostly the information was unidirectional CITATION Nic12 \l 1033 (Nicholls, 2012). Social media enables all users to engage and discuss issues, topics etc. with the information source hence making the communication process more efficient. Public health organizations are able to have personalized communication with the users who contact them directly regarding any of the messages they post. Those who seek clarification on any message are able to do so easily through their social media accounts.
On the other hand, social media is not an authoritative source of information especially today in the age of ‘fake news.’ There are always more pages which are cloned by malicious individuals seeking to ride on the reputation of the organization and get more ‘likes, retweets etc. CITATION Pat17 \l 1033 (Wright, 2017).’ These pages are created faster than they can be tracked and brought down often after doing some damage. Most people get information from these clones of the official page which is often wrong, unsubstantiated and misleading.
Secondly, the social media is often ineffective in some situation especially is the internet infrastructure is destroyed. Following the havoc caused by hurricane Irma in Puerto Rico and recently hurricane Florence in Carolina, the electricity grid and internet infrastructure is often destroyed and takes time to get it back. During this time, the efficacy of the social media as an information disseminating platform is severely hampered and new avenues for doing the same ought to be established.
